Hole 3 at Memorial Park Golf Course

Par 5587 Yards • Houston, Texas

The third hole at Memorial Park Golf Course presents a classic risk-reward par 5 that epitomizes strategic golf design. At 587 yards, this straight-away hole invites aggressive play while demanding precision throughout. The generous fairway provides ample room off the tee, encouraging golfers to unleash their drivers and set up potential eagle opportunities.

What makes Memorial Park Golf Course hole 3 particularly challenging is the small green complex that awaits at the end of this lengthy journey. Players must carefully consider their approach strategy—whether to go for the green in two with a long iron or hybrid, or lay up to a comfortable wedge distance. The compact putting surface demands accurate iron play and rewards those who can control their distance. Without significant hazards to navigate, success hinges purely on execution and course management, making this a true test of golfing fundamentals and strategic thinking.
